Indeed: micro-män combines the competencies of highprecision moldmaking, valve gate technology, and electrical injection molding technology. The concept departs from that of traditional injection molding machines beginning right with its basic design. With a cooled, single-piece machine plate made of steel as well as three-point supports, the sturdy design is similar to that of a highprecision measuring device. Page 1 of 5

2 The all-electric injection unit and closing unit are driven by state-of-theart torque motors, eliminating the need for a gear unit. This provides benefits in terms of maintenance, wear, efficiency, and precision. micro-män is different from conventional injection molding machines in that the vario-thermal process and removal of the parts take place outside the closing unit. The core element of this concept is track-män: the two-piece mold half has a mold insert as well as an integrated ejection pack and is conveyed out of the closing unit after injection to the individual function stations. The production cell is standard-equipped with four function modules to which track-män is conducted by a transportation system. The transportation system is composed of longitudinally arranged linear units. At the vertices, the mold halves are moved by pneumatic rotary drives. After injection, the movable mold half is conducted together with the molded part to the cooling station. The contact cooling is water based. Two removal stations follow: one for the gate and one for the injectionmolded part. Next is the heating station, which heats the mold in a twostage inductive process, and from there back to injection. Thus, the system performs multiple processes simultaneously, ensuring a high frequency rate. The system s key feature: using multiple mold halves within a production cycle makes it possible to produce parts with different geometries without retooling the machine. This is especially advantageous in the production of small amounts and a crucial benefit in terms of costeffectiveness. In addition, the mold half can be equipped with a chip that stores the required injection parameters, ensuring optimum production conditions for each injection-molded part. The micro-män 50 concept provides the option of integrating additional modules such as an insertion module or assembly unit into the linear system of the production cell. The injection unit is designed to enable processing of commercially available granules. Two-stage screw preplasticization with piston Page 2 of 5

3 injection operates on a first-in/first-out basis. This minimizes the dwell time of the molding material, enabling higher frequency rates. Depending on the piston diameter, the injection unit can attain an injection pressure of up to 3,000 bar. Users especially will appreciate the excellent accessibility of micro-män. The large screens can be fully lowered to allow complete access to the workspace. The upper area of the housing is designed to permit optional integration of a flow box. 5 About männer Solutions for Plastics männer specializes in high-precision molds, valve gate hot runner systems, and system solutions for the medical & pharmaceutical, packaging, and personal & health care industries. männer offers an ideal array of products and services for large-volume production of high-grade plastic parts. For more than 45 years, the männer name has stood for quality, reliability, longevity, and high cost-effectiveness. männer is among the industry's leading suppliers, with around 380 employees and production, sales, and service locations in Europe, the USA, and Asia.
